Charity Information
Drama workshops for disadvantaged young people. Workshops for unemployed people which use drama techniques to help them find work. Working with volunteers to make accessible community theatre. Cooperating with other arts and educational organisations. Promoting New Writing. Creating projects exploring heritage and history. Producing new plays. Producing play readings. Training volunteers.
